381085863365926213485912018196730888601608
Even
381085863365926213485912018196730888601608 is even
Previous even number is 381085863365926213485912018196730888601606
Next even number is 381085863365926213485912018196730888601610
Cubed
55343741463604300553086998530773679956170641802802430434790856022523297778636768134203312611575486364169629574376067248947712
Squared
145226435257353382855104033309283047498945431255650692506392125179866296497740185664
Binary
1000101111111101001001000111001000001011100011001111110111000101001011001111101100110011000110001100100000100001111000100000100000000001000